About the course
Develop specialist skills for transport and logistics operations, planning and supply chain coordination. The course focuses on contemporary industry practices including risk management, operations planning and emerging technologies such as blockchain in supply chain management. You’ll build practical capability to support logistics functions and improve efficiency across freight and distribution networks in this Diploma-level business discipline. The programme introduces business operations, customer service, and administrative leadership for commercial workplaces.
Career outcome
Graduates can pursue entry to mid-level roles supporting logistics and supply chain activities across transport, warehousing and distribution. Typical opportunities include logistics clerk or coordinator, dispatch and inventory support, scheduling and operations administration, and pathway roles toward logistics management. This Diploma qualification prepares you for work in the logistics and supply chain sector within business and commerce. Preparing graduates for supervisory, administration, and business support roles, or degree articulation.
